Harnessing Solar Energy: The latest Innovations and Future Prospects

Solar energy has undergone remarkable transformations since its inception as a key contender in the renewable energy sector. As we move through the 21st century, developments in solar technology continue to amaze with innovation and efficiency improvements leading the charge.

In recent years, the global drive for sustainable energy solutions has fueled significant advancements in solar technologies. From increased efficiency in silicon solar cells to the advent of novel materials like perovskite, researchers are exploring the limits of what solar panels can accomplish.

A pivotal innovation shaking the solar industry is the rise of bifacial solar panels. Unlike traditional models, bifacial solar panels capture sunlight on both sides, enhancing energy production by 10-20%. This development has immense implications for solar farms, where land use is optimized, and efficiency is paramount.

Another revolutionary advancement is in transparent solar panels. While initially confined to small-scale applications, these see-through wonders are now being integrated into architectural designs, transforming windows into electricity generators. This has the potential to reshape urban landscapes, making buildings not only visually appealing but functionally efficient.

Energy storage, a traditional bottleneck in solar energy adoption, is experiencing its technological renaissance. New battery technologies, including lithium-sulfur and solid-state batteries, promise to hold more energy and operate safely over longer periods, thereby complementing solar energy systems beautifully.

The integration of Artificial Intelligence (AI) in solar energy management systems has opened new vistas for efficiency. AI-driven analytics offer predictive maintenance and efficiency optimizations that were previously unfathomable. This technological marriage is reducing costs and making solar energy more accessible to developing regions.

While technology paves the way, policy and financial innovations bolster the solar movement. The decline in solar panel costs, coupled with innovative financing models like solar leases and Power Purchase Agreements (PPAs), have democratized solar energy uptake across various socio-economic spectra.

In centering equity in the energy transition, community solar projects are pivotal. These initiatives allow individuals who reside in condos or rental homes to purchase shares in solar farms, granting them access to clean energy and reduced bills without needing individual installations.

Looking to the future, promising emerging technologies like solar paint hint at a world where solar harvesting will be more integral than ever. This innovation allows literally any surface to capture solar energy, pushing the envelope of solar capability.

As we witness these advancements, challenges remain. Material scarcity, especially the rare earth elements used in solar productions, presents a significant barrier. However, recycling initiatives and synthetic alternatives offer hope for sustainable supplies.

In addition to structural challenges, the variability of sunlight and regional disparities in energy need versus sunlight availability present hurdles. Investments in transmission infrastructure and cross-border energy trading could mitigate these challenges, enhancing global energy coherence.
